If you are facing an unexpected pregnancy right now and feeling scared and lost, this may not be much of a consolation but you are not alone. In fact, figures say that almost 50% of all pregnancies in the US every year are unplanned. Never think that it’s the end of the world for you. There are options out there available for you whether it’s abortion or San Diego CA abortion clinic alternatives that you can choose to be able to effectively address your present situation and come out from the whole experience physically and emotionally unscathed.

If you are determined to terminate your pregnancy, no one should stop you from having an abortion if you believe it is the right option for you to take. In general, it is a safe procedure. However, you should find the right provider that will ensure you of a safe and effective treatment. This is vital especially if your only option is surgical abortion.

Finding a good abortion clinic can be tough. While there may be a number of choices out there, not all are the same in terms of the services they offer and the quality and cost of these services. Also, not all have a conducive environment that you’ll feel comfortable in. With the right research however, you can end up with one that offers high-quality care at a cost you can afford. To help you choose a good abortion clinic, get referrals from your healthcare provider or from someone you trust particularly one who has had the procedure before. Be wary of facilities whose ads you saw in the yellow pages or from the internet. Sometimes, they are not really who they say they are. Regardless of how you find a provider, however, make sure to check it out in person. See if its clean and sanitary. Ask about the services they offer, the qualifications of their doctors, their emergency plans, and so on.

Don’t hesitate to ask about the cost of the procedure. Inquire what is included in the charge. Does it cover the cost of the medication, the lab work, etc? Do they take your insurance policy? If they don’t, do they have payment options that you can avail so you don’t have to pay the whole amount at once? In the end, you have to trust your instinct. If something doesn’t feel right, move on and consider another provider.
